Digital Transformation is driving a rapid increase in investment in art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) technologies as enterprises seek a competitive edge.

However, the adoption of AI/ML-based initiatives can be challenging in a changing IT landscape. Moving from POC to production is often difficult. Systems prove difficult to optimize or are unable to scale to the required response times, and leaders have concerns over governance and compliance for vast amounts of unstructured data.

So why are organizations fixed on this adoption? Because it works.

The Enterprise Strategy Group (ESG) recently reported 82 percent of organizations saw value from AI/ML in six months or less after implementation. This success is fueling interest and investment in this data-driven digital transformation.

However, this transformation can be stalled when organizations realize the scale of data required to implement a successful AI/ML initiative, often resulting in systems drowning in data, crippled by performance bottlenecks, or cannot meet the immense throughput demands.

This is because current IT systems are not designed for the complexities of AI, and relying on standard IT architectures exposes problems not seen at a smaller scale. To ensure AI/ML initiatives produce the valuable insights management expects, organizations need intelligent infrastructure designed from the ground up with their data needs in mind from the very beginning.
